目次
基本
- ホーム - フレームワークの紹介
- 要件 - FuelPHP を実行するために何が必要?
- ライセンス - ソースコードのライセンス
- 貢献 - 貢献の仕方
- クレジット表示 - FuelPHP を偉大にした人への謝辞!
インストール
概要
- クラス
- はじめに - FuelPHP でのクラスの構造と定義
- Core の拡張 - FuelPHP の Core クラスにあなたのコードを追加する方法
- コーディング標準 - Pull Request を送る前に必ずお読みください!
- 設定 - グローバルなフレームワークの設定
- 定数 - 使用できる定数
- 複数環境 - 異なる環境であなたのアプリケーションを実行する
- Model-View-Controller - Model-View-Controller 原則の紹介
- モデル - モデルとは、そしてどう使う?
- ビュー - 出力を作成する
- ビューモデル - 表示ロジックのビューテンプレートからの分離
- コントローラ
- ベース - コントローラとは、どのように機能する?
- Template - テンプレートを使った出力のためのベースコントローラ
- Rest - RESTful な API のためのベースコントローラ
- Hybrid - テンプレートを使った出力と RESTful API を結合したベースコントローラ
- ルーティング - URI リクエストをコントローラのアクションにルーティングする
- セキュリティ - 安全なアプリケーションの作成を確かなものにする
- モジュール - あなたのアプリケーションをモジュール化し、モジュールをポータブルに
- パッケージ - Core を拡張する
- HMVC リクエスト - コントローラから別のコントローラを呼び出し、結合を弱める
- マイグレーション - データベーススキーマのような、あなたのアプリケーション環境への漸進的な変化
- タスク - コマンドラインやスケジューラからバックグラウンドタスクを実行する
- ユニットテスト - PHPUnit であなたのコードをテストする
- エラー処理 - あなたのアプリケーションのエラーを処理する
- プロファイリング - 私のメモリはどこに行ったの? どんなクエリが生成されたの? どれが遅いの?
サードパーティ
FuelPHP Core
Classes
- Agent - ユーザエージェントの情報
- Arr - 配列操作のためのユーティリティクラス
- Asset - 画像、スクリプト、CSS ファイルと連携する
- Autoloader
- Cache - 様々なストレージバックエンドにデータをキャッシュする
- Cli - コマンドライン上でユーザとやりとりするためのユーティリティクラス
- Config - アプリケーションの設定にアクセスする
- Cookie - クッキーを扱う
- Crypt - 暗号化と復号
- Database - オブジェクト指向のクエリビルダー
- Date - 日時、タイムゾーンを扱う
- Debug - デバッグ機能のユーティリティクラス
- Event - イベント駆動のアプリケーションを作成する
- Error
- Exception
- Fieldset - HTML フォームを生成するオブジェクト指向の方法
- Finder - ファイルを検索しロードする
- Form - HTML フォーム要素を生成するユーティリティクラス
- Format - データのフォーマットを変換する
- Ftp - FTP を使いファイルを送信または受信する
- Fuel - FuelPHP フレームワークのブートストラップクラス
- Html - HTML 要素を生成するユーティリティクラス
- Image - GD や ImageMagick を使い画像操作
- Inflector
- Input - すべてのソースからの入力を処理する
- Lang - アプリケーションを多言語化する
- Log - Monolog ロガーパッケージへの静的なインターフェイス
- Markdown - Markdown パーサークラス
- Migrate - マイグレーションをリストし実行する
- Model_Crud - データベース操作のための基本的なベースモデル
- Module - 使用可能なモジュールをロード、アンロード、リストする
- Mongo_Db - Interface to Mongo DB
- Num - 数字を扱うユーティリティクラス
- Package - 使用可能なパッケージをロード、アンロード、リストする
- Pagination - あなたの表をページネートするための HTML を生成する
- Profiler - アプリケーションをプロファイリングする
- Redis_Db - Redis へのインターフェイス
- Request - 追加のリクエストを発射する
- URI リクエスト - 内部の MVC または HMVC コール
- Curl - Curl ライブラリを使い外部の (RESTful な) データをロードする
- Soap - SOAP を使いアプリケーションの相互運用
- Response - 返されるレスポンス
- Router - FuelPHP のリクエストルーティングエンジン
- Security - アプリケーションを簡単にセキュアにするためのユーティリティクラス
- Session - ステートレスな環境で状態を維持する
- Str - 文字列の操作のためのユーティリティクラス
- Theme - テーマ機能でアプリケーションの出力生成を次のレベルに
- Unzip - Zip ファイルを解凍する
- Upload - アップロードファイルを検証し処理する
- Uri - URI と URL を扱うユーティリティクラス
- Validation - 簡単に定義できるルールを使いデータを検証する
- View - オブジェクト指向の出力
Auth パッケージ
Email パッケージ
Oil パッケージ
Orm パッケージ
Parser パッケージ